My Preferred cure macro is the following:
This will show all the spell information (help text, global cool down, etc.).Code:/macroicon "Cure" /ac "Cure" <mo> /ac "Cure" <t> /ac "Cure" <me>
Use Cure on the mouse over target so I can hover over the party list and cure from there.
If there is no mouse over then it will cure my target (usually the tank).
I also explicitly have it fall through to cure me if there is no target. It may just work like that by default, but I like to be explicit just in case.
